In South Africa today, perimeter security is a major concern for homeowners, and if you are planning on selling your property then it is a very important point to keep in mind.
What is the first thing anyone sees when they approach your property?
Your boundary wall or fence.
First impressions count. If your boundary wall is shabby, not properly maintained and is cracking or pealing, then it does not matter how well your house is maintained, the look of your boundary wall will be the impression indelibly printed in a potential buyer’s mind.
The impression will cause the potential buyer to believe that your house is not as well maintained as it appears to be.
It is best to repair or replace boundary walls before putting your property on the market. That way you are assured of a much better price and an easier sale.
Your boundary wall or fence should always enhance and add to the aesthetic beauty of your property.
Potential buyers will also be keeping their eye on the security value of the boundary wall or fence. Your fencing or walling should not look distinctly inferior in any way to any of your neighbours.
This is when keeping up with the Joneses is an effective route to follow. Security is important, so your walling or fencing should show that it is a priority for you too.
It is always a good idea to go out of your property to take a really long hard look at your property to get the real street view of where your property stands in the security and aesthetic beauty of the area.
If all your neighbours have electric fencing and palisades and you do not, it will be immediately noticeable to potential buyers. You do not want your property to stick out like a sore thumb.
Many property owners have chosen to raise their walls or fences by adding electric fencing or palisades to existing structures. This enhances the security and is also aesthetically pleasing.
